Job Functions:
  • Design robust mechanical modules and subsystems incorporating mixed signal RF and digital electronics using 3D CAD software.
  • Develop rugged mechanical hardware such as heat sinks and enclosures for 3U and 6U VPX modules that comply with VITA standards and environmental specifications.
  • Perform computational fluid dynamics (CFD) analysis to simulate thermal performance of designs to ensure compliance with thermal requirements.
  • Conduct finite element analysis (FEA) to perform frequency, structural, and static studies on modules and subsystems to determine resonant frequencies, stress, strain, and fatigue life.
  • Generate detailed fabrication drawings incorporating geometric dimensioning and tolerancing (GD&T).
  • Create thorough assembly instructions, bill of materials (BOMs), and test reports for designs.
  • Assist in the preparation and submission of data packages and contract deliverable reports.
  • Support engineering requests from various functional areas, including Manufacturing, Procurement, and Quality.
  • Collaborate with systems, PCB layout, and RF engineers in cross-functional teams throughout product development lifecycles.
  • Support the evaluation of customer proposals, assess mechanical design feasibility, and help refine requirements for successful implementation.
